I'm really intrigued by the freewheel. I've only recently gotten back into unicycling and we didn't have this before. Is there a brake in the hub that's activated by backward pressure on the pedals?
It’s so much fun now, but it took a while to feel fun due to the totally different feeling from the fixed type. In terms of brake, it’s same as the normal lever disc brake in use on a muni.
@@leopardmuni oh wow, that sounds really hard. Even when pedaling forward we're used to putting in some back pressure on the pedals to correct our balance.
@@HellOnWheel yeah, so when I just started, I got slammed on the ground several times. And also it feels so different when we are hopping cause we use the front foot mainly on a freewheel. For your reference, It’ll be easier for you to understand when you remember how a normal bicycle works.
